Heavy metal legend King Diamond has unveiled a haunting music video for his latest single, “Spider Lilly”. Fresh off a fall tour together, Danish multi-instrumentalist Myrkur lends her ethereal backing vocals to the track. The eerie visual was brought to life by director David Brodsky (Cattle Decapitation, Entheos).
Some of the video’s filming took place at the infamous Pennhurst Asylum in Spring City, PA, just two days before Halloween. Reflecting on the experience, King Diamond shared:
“What a dark but great experience. Hopefully, that was not the last video we will be able to film there. There are already several tales waiting to be told about all that has happened before, during, and after the birth of the song ‘Spider Lilly’.”
The track, mixed by Arthur Rizk (Soulfly, Code Orange), offers the first glimpse into an ambitious new horror trilogy from King Diamond. The series’ inaugural release is titled Saint Lucifer’s Hospital 1920 and promises more chills to come.
